'A knife in the ball means the muti is dead!”'
October 22, 2009
Soccer in South Africa has changed enormously over the last 15 or 20 years…Former Usuthu legend
George Dearnaley reminds of how things were
back in the day…

AmaZulu in the early 1990’s was a very ‘traditional’ club, and the players adhered to the rituals and the ceremonies without too many complaints.
I had ‘bathed’ in some foul-smelling brown stuff a few times, and I had stood over and wafted the smoke from a small fire in our dressing room all over me. This fire was made out of some small pieces of wood and other herbs that would make me invincible!
I had stuff smeared on me, and I wore my jersey the one match after spraying a whole can of deodorant on it to kill the smell of some ‘muti’.
So there weren’t too many things that fazed me during my time at AmaZulu. The only thing I refused to do was to drink or eat anything that was considered ‘muti’. I thought I had seen it all, but an incident in a match against Umtata Bush Bucks left me speechless.
I was injured for the match, and took my place in the stands with the supporters. I enjoyed sitting in among the home fans when I wasn’t playing, listening to their comments on my teammates and finding out how they watched the match. At half-time the score between AmaZulu and Umtata Bucks was 0 – 0.
As the players made their way into the dressing rooms, the Bucks reserve players strolled across the field and had a kick around in the one goal area. One of their players picked the ball up and started smacking it into the net.
The Usuthu supporters were getting aggressive and they started shouting at the Bucks players. The stadium security ran on to the field and one of them confiscated the ball from the Bucks players. He walked over to the grandstand and in full view of the home supporters he stabbed the ball!
This was met with a loud roar. One old guy next to me explained that Bucks were going to attack that specific goal in the second half, and that they were ‘blessing’ the goal area with the ball, but by stabbing the ball, AmaZulu had killed the muti…the game ended 0 – 0.
